Library to control a QVGA TFT connected to SPI. You can use printf to print text The lib can handle different fonts, draw lines, circles, rect and bmp

+#ifndef MBED_SPI_TFT_H
+#define MBED_SPI_TFT_H
+
+#include "mbed.h"
+#include "GraphicsDisplay.h"
+
+#define RGB(r,g,b)  (((r&0xF8)<<8)|((g&0xFC)<<3)|((b&0xF8)>>3)) //5 red | 6 green | 5 blue
+
+#define SPI_START   (0x70)              /* Start byte for SPI transfer        */
+#define SPI_RD      (0x01)              /* WR bit 1 within start              */
+#define SPI_WR      (0x00)              /* WR bit 0 within start              */
+#define SPI_DATA    (0x02)              /* RS bit 1 within start byte         */
+#define SPI_INDEX   (0x00)              /* RS bit 0 within start byte         */
+
